This article summarizes the land salinization in the development and the current mechanism and theuse of saline-alkali soil improvement of the status quo. focuses on the western region of the jilin provincein the distribution of saline soil conditions improved over the years and the use of progress. On this basisto the western Jilin soda severe soil salinity study (pH>10, ESP>60%). A pot and field trials, the rightmodifier for screening test, Through modifier different amount of soil properties and effectes of thedevelopment of the crop growth, Examine its severe salinization of the soil to improve results.The results showed that different modifier on soil physical properties are different, With the activationof calcium dosage increase, 1~0.25mm soil micro-aggregates content gradually increase, Bulk density isgradually declining.The descent of the bulk density showed that compact,bad structure soil become loose,The improvement of 1~0.25mm microaggregate showed that the soil granule structure was amelioratedand it formed a good soil granule structure which fits for the growth of the plant.The soil fertility wasimoroved.Different modifier to improve soil chemical properties also have different performance. As theincrease of the using level of activator,the pH,total alkalinity,exchangeable sodium droppedquickly,which was very obvious But as far as the treatment that had not calcium activator isconcerned,the physical and chemical character of the soil is same to the original soil,which showed theactivating effect of the calcium activator. Calcium activating agent in improved alkaline earth play a largerole. Also, perhaps because of the short time, there is mot significant diference among the improvement ofthe enzyme activity and nutrition in the soil.There was mot significant diference among the treatments.Different modifier formula on soil properties and crop growth and development of the integratedeffects, Calcium-containing substances, calcium activator and the husks of improving the results obviously,and the study of pre-screening results are consistent formula.Modifier used in the creation of different dosage pot experiment, The results show different modifieramount of soil physical properties are different, With modifier usage, Soil bulk density decreased gradually,And the permeability coefficient has gradually increasing trend, This trend can be seen soil physicalstructure gradually improved.In soil chemical properties of different modifier usage also showed different effects, Soil pH,exchangeable sodium, alkali, CO32- and HCO3- are with the amount of the increase result to reduced, Saltand total control compared to a different extent, K+, Na+ content reduced, Ca2+, Mg2+ content increased. Shi-modifier after soil nutrient content and an increase compared to the control, Organic matter, alkali-soluble nitrogen, available phosphorus, potassium content effectively have different degrees ofimprovement, But different dosage little difference.Modifier different test for the amount of the wheat crop growth and development of impact isdifferent. With modifier usage, Emergence increased gradually, Height, fresh weight, Ear Weight tends toincrease. When the content reaches a certain value, Height, fresh weight, the slow increase of 10-dayintervals, The difference between the amount was not significant, Note there is a most appropriate dosage.Upon analysis of the experimental conditions more suitable dosage of 2.5kg/m2.The trial of the modifier improved alkaline earth a short time, effective, to improve the severe soilsalinity. It's a rapid decline of soil pH and removes Na2CO3. The mechanism may be: modifier of calciumphosphate gypsum material and superphosphate itself acidic. Calcium is an activator acid, added toalkaline earth occurred, and acid-base reaction, quickly reduce the soil PH. Phosphogypsum SSP and theactivation of calcium by the calcium-activated, can be exchanged on the soil colloid adsorption of sodium,soil exchangeable sodium content, that is, to lower the alkaline soil, alkaline soil-improvement The highlydispersed colloidal quickly formed a micro-aggregates, improving ventilation Permeability. Another Ca2+and CO32- reaction, forming calcium carbonate precipitation, in the soil environment CO32- and HCO3- canbe transformed into each other, in a dynamic equilibrium, This will largely reduce the soil CO32- andHCO3- content so that the soil to reduce the Na2CO3 for desalination of saline-alkali soil from the base tocreate the conditions.
